20080253543Multi-User System for Call Back Call-Through and Follow Me Features Using Analogs Lines and Data Link - A digital telephony system which provides telephone services to a plurality of subscribers. The system includes a private branch exchange (PBX) which provides multiple analog telephone lines and includes an interface to a data link. The multi-user system which provides telephone services to subscribers not associated with the PBX, is connected to the PBX by the analog telephone lines. A subscriber accesses the multi-user system by initiating a connection to the multi-user system such as a telephone connection or a message over a cellular network. The multi-user system receives information regarding the telephone connection over the data link thereby generating a call event; and triggers an action based on the information received by synchronizing one of the analog lines to the call event. Preferably the action includes intercepting, or call-back actions, which provide the services to the external subscribers using functionality available in the PBX.10-16-2008

20090309094COLOR CONTROLLED ELECTROLUMINESCENT DEVICES - An organic electroluminescent device of a composite material that includes at least two emissive polymers confined into a layered inorganic host matrix, which effectively isolates the polymer chains from their neighbors, and a method for manufacturing same. The isolation of the emitting chains inhibits energy transfer and exciton diffusion between polymer chains, such that the electrically generated excitons recombine radiatively before their energy could be funneled to the emissive moiety with the lowest band gap. The emission color of such a composite is a combination of the emission of the confined polymers, and can be either white light, or can be tuned by selection of the ratio of the mixtures to output light of any desired color. The different polymers can either be mixed and then intercalated into the host matrix, or they can each be intercalated separately into the host matrix and the resulting composites mixed.12-17-2009

20110201315PROVIDING WEB-ACTIVATED CALLBACK BY JUST DIALLING AND PRESSING THE CALL BUTTON - The application relates to web-activated callback for wireless phones. Web-activated callback such as JAJAH is known. To originate a call when using conventional web-activated callback, a user must connect to the Internet, activate the web browser, log into his account, request callback while specifying caller and callee phone number, and finally answer the incoming call that was set up by the callback server. However, the combination of steps is considered problematic. Therefore, the major object of the application is to enable user of wireless phones to make use of web-activated callback by just dialling or selecting a callee phone number from a contact list and pressing the “CALL” button to originate a call. The object is achieved in that a software running on the wireless phone hides all the above mentioned steps from the user. Hence, it will be invisible to the user that a callback service is being used in particular because the software receives and answers the incoming call from the callback server.08-18-2011

20100246952METHOD AND SYSTEM FOR IMAGE RESTORATION IN THE SPATIAL DOMAIN - Method and system embodiments of the present invention are directed to restoration of corrupted images using spatial-domain image-processing methods that can effectively employ spatial-domain information both in order to avoid various types of artifacts and distortions produced by frequency-domain image-processing operations and to achieve computational efficiency. The various method and system embodiments of the present invention employ a family of penalty functions to constrain iterative restoration images corrupted by both deterministic corruptions, such as motion-induced blur and blurring due to optical misalignment, incorrect positioning of optical components, and defective optical components as well as essentially non-deterministic noise corruption introduced at various stages of image acquisition, image encoding, image storage, and image transmission.09-30-2010
20110125548BUSINESS SERVICES RISK MANAGEMENT - A business service model includes a description of a topology of interconnections between configuration items that implement a business service. Each of the configuration items is associated with a respective vulnerability score and a respective type classification. Based on the vulnerability scores and the type classifications, the following values are determined for each of the configuration items: a respective activity level value indicating a probability of the configuration item being active in the business process, a respective vulnerability probability value indicating a probability of the configuration items being compromised and damaged in the business process, and a respective business process risk value indicating a probability of a failure of the business process resulting from damage of the configuration item. The business process is scored based on the activity level values, the vulnerability values, and the business process risk values.05-26-2011

20120029880METHOD AND SYSTEM FOR DETERMINING A SPECTRAL VECTOR FROM MEASURED ELECTRO-MAGNETIC-RADIAION INTENSITIES - Embodiments of the present invention are directed to determining the spectral vector of electromagnetic radiation reflected from, transmitted through, or emitted from a sample using a set of n intensity measurements. In general, the spectral vector has a dimension k that is greater than the number of measured intensities n. However, in many cases, the physical and chemical constraints of a system, when properly identified and modeled, effectively reduce the number of unknowns, generally the k components of the spectral vector, to an extent that allows for the spectral vector to be characterized from a relatively small number n of measured intensities.02-02-2012
